All natural, wonderful soy candles that will scent any room very nicely. 

These candles burn cleanly and are made of natural soy wax. The wax will also last longer than traditional paraffin wax. Since these candles burn more slowly, they don't release a distinct aroma, but are more gentle than the paraffin wax candles. 

Soy wax is made from soybeans, making it a vegetable by-product. It is biodegradable and a renewable resource. Soy wax candles burn cleaner than paraffin wax meaning that there is no soot in your home from burning it. Using soybean by-products supports American farmers!

This candle will burn for approximately 65-70 hours. Actual burn time will vary depending on environmental conditions (i.e. fans, open windows, temperature).
